I've never seen place like Molly's before. All the dogs are free-roaming. When you enter, you are greeted by a cavalcade of smiling faces. It is so much easier to find the right pet for you when you can see it in its home environment. At other shelters you can take a dog out of a cage for 10 minutes, where they are either so excited to be out, or scared out of their minds. The free-roaming floor at Molly's lets you see how the animal is with other dogs, people, kids, even cats. You get a much better since of their personality and can make a much more informed decision about who would be the right pet for you.

Their second positive attribute is their elevated puppy pens. Not only does it provide the puppies with their own clean, temp. controlled room, but the windows allow people to, once again, see the puppy with its litter mates. Elevating them also keeps the puppies clear of diseases the adult dogs might carry. It is a safer, cleaner environment than chain-link cages and cold cement floors.

Molly's Place truly is dedicated to improving the lives of animals through rescue, education, spay/neuter, and adoption. Their staff is very knowledgable and know all the dogs by name. They can tell you all about someone's personality and are not shy to give you the pros and cons to help you make the right decision for your family.
